Breakout Role and Key Television Work

Dunham’s breakthrough arrived with the HBO series Girls, which she created, wrote, directed, and starred in from 2012 to 2017. The show generated significant discussion about millennial life, creative ambition, and representation in media. Her responsibilities expanded across departments, highlighting her as a showrunner and auteur in addition to her central performance. This section outlines her contributions and how they shaped the series.

Creative Scope and Onscreen Responsibilities

As creator and lead, Dunham influenced casting, editorial direction, and narrative structure. She balanced writing, directing episodes, and performing, which affected production timelines and storytelling consistency. Her work prompted industry conversations about authenticity, female perspective, and the boundaries between personal experience and character drama.

  • Primary role: Lead actress, writer, director, executive producer
  • Key focus: Honest portrayals of young adulthood, relationships, and creative struggle
  • Industry impact: Expanded debates on representation and behind-the-camera access for showrunners

Film Roles and Notable Collaborations

Alongside television, Dunham has appeared in several feature films, often in roles connected to her creative interests or collaborations with trusted directors. These projects allowed her to explore different genres and working methods. The following table details select film credits, years, and their general reception or significance.

Film Title Year Role Verified Detail Source Type
Tiny Furniture 2010 Director, writer, lead actress Premiered at major festivals; launched her feature profile Festival records
Honey Boy 2019 Actress (supporting) Written by Shia LaBeouf; cameo role alongside her Production notes
My Blind Brother 2016 Actress Comedy-drama with a supporting performance Release materials

Critical Reception and Public Profile

Discussions of Dunham’s work often reference her visibility as a young female creator prioritizing personal narratives. Critics have debated whether her prominence reflects substantive industry change or represents a high-profile example given limited opportunities. Audience reactions have been polarized at times, and she has addressed controversy directly in interviews and public statements. This section explains how her public profile has evolved.

Key Themes in Coverage

Media analysis of Dunham frequently touches on authenticity, representation, and the blending of biography with fiction. Scholars and journalists have examined her influence on conversations about gender, mental health, and creative authority. While interpretations vary, her work remains a reference point in ongoing discussions about independent and auteurist television.
